It fixed my 'sloppy' up shifting, but now I can really feel it downshift. I wonder if I need to give it some more time to adjust to my driving habbits. Or I wonder if the update made another issue I have more noticiable? When I am coasting to a stop under light braking I can feel it go down the gears and really thump into 1st, the RPM's even jump when it downshifts.

Delaer was more than happy to check for an update when I asked them, cost me $94.00.

The re-flash must program the PCM back to default settings, as I too noticed a firmer shift when I first got it done. Now that I've put some miles on it, it's learned a little more softness to its shift quality, but it's still better than it was.

I had my PCM updated a few months back... and now my superchips programmer wont work!


Yup, if your programmer is "installed" when they do a re-flash, the programmer can't unlock itself because it can't remove the flash it installed. Superchips may be able to reset it for you. But you'll pay for it.
